Priming of CD4 T cells and IgE responses initiated by alum are reduced in STING−/− mice, and these effects are independent of type I IFNs. (A) STING−/− or WT littermate control mice were immunized with 10 μg of 3K-ova + 200 μg of Alhydrogel in the calf muscle. Before injection, the antigen/adjuvant was mixed with either 5 mg of BSA or DNase I. Popliteal LNs were harvested 7 d after immunization and stained with tetramers and Abs as described in Materials and Methods. Bars on the graph show the mean total number of 3K/IAb tetramer-positive CD44hi CD4 T cells per mouse. Data are combined from two experiments (n = 6 mice per group). (B) STING−/− or WT littermate control mice were immunized with 10 μg of ova (Ova) + alum. Sera were tested for the presence of ova-specific Abs 14 d later. RU, relative units. (C) STING−/− mice were primed and boosted with 10 μg of ova (Ova) + 200 μg of alum, and ova-specific IgE Abs in the sera were analyzed 7 d after the boost by ELISA. Ab data are combined from two separate experiments. Lines on the graphs indicate means, and the error bars indicate SEM. (D) B6 WT mice and IFNAR−/− mice were injected with 10 μg of 3K-ova and 200 μg of Alhydrogel in the calf muscle and compared with naive controls (open bars). Before injection, the antigen/adjuvant was mixed with either 5 mg of BSA (black bars) or DNase I (gray bars). Popliteal LNs were harvested 7 d after immunization and stained with tetramers and Abs as described in Materials and Methods. Bars on graphs show the mean total number of 3K/IAb tetramer-positive CD44hi CD4 T cells per mouse. Data are from a single representative of two experiments (n = 4 mice per group). Statistical differences in A and D were determined using one-way ANOVA with a Bonferroni posttest. Statistical differences in B and C were determined using an unpaired t test. *P < 0.05; **P < 0.01; ***P < 0.001; not significant (ns) indicates P > 0.05 for select comparisons.
